Mell’s Gardening – Local Gardener in Lewes
Hi, I’m Mell -a 28-year-old gardener recently back in my hometown of Lewes after spending the last few years working and living in Brighton. I grew up here, and I’m now looking to build a local client base rooted in trust, quality, and care.
I’ve been working outdoors professionally since I was 15—over 12 years now. I studied at Plumpton College and have spent most of my time working professionally as a gardener. I’ve also spent time on biodynamic farms, helped build natural swimming ponds, planted trees in the Australian outback for a year, and worked for both organic nurseries and a landscaping companies as well as various local companies. My approach is grounded in ecology and sustainability, but I still offer all the practical services too—hedge cutting, lawn mowing, general garden maintenance, and tidy-ups.
I don’t drive, so I’m mainly working in Lewes and the surrounding areas, though I can travel a bit through arranged lifts from family members. I’m not taking on large-scale landscaping or design projects at the moment—just keeping it simple and local.
